Indian American Woman to be Honoured as 'Champions of Change'
- Thursday July 16, 2015
- Indians Abroad | Press Trust of India
An Indian American woman is among 12 faith leaders to be honoured as "Champions of Change" by the White House for their efforts in protecting environment and communities from the effects of climate change.

Hindus find a Ganges in Queens
- Friday April 22, 2011
- World News | Sam Dolnick, The New York Times
It was just after dawn last Sunday when a pair of pilgrims lighted incense on the shore and dropped two coconuts into the sacred waters, otherwise known as Jamaica Bay.
